Morgan County, Illinois Citizen Voting-age Population By Race and Ethnicity in 2014 (ACS-5Yrs)
Based on the US Census Bureau's special tabulation from the ACS 5-year estimates, in 2014, the citizen voting-age population for Morgan County, IL was 27.73K. The Non-Hispanic White Alone ethnicity group had the highest citizen voting-age population (25.39K) and constituted 91.58% of the total.
The Non-Hispanic Black or African American Alone ethnicity group had the second highest citizen voting-age population (1.69K) and constituted 6.08% of the total. The Hispanic or Latino of All Races ethnicity group had the third highest (430), constituting 1.55% of the total citizen voting-age population.

| Ethnicity | Voting-age Population | % of Voting-age Pop. |
|---|---|---|
| Non-Hispanic White Alone | 25390 | 91.58 |
| Non-Hispanic Black or African American Alone | 1685 | 6.08 |
| Hispanic or Latino of All Races | 430 | 1.55 |
| Non-Hispanic Two Or More Races | 149 | 0.54 |
| Non-Hispanic Asian Alone | 40 | 0.14 |
| Non-Hispanic American Indian and Alaska Native Alone | 25 | 0.09 |
